Electoral Amendment Bill 2000 |
Bill No. | 134 |
Long Title | The purpose of this Bill is to implement a number of changes recommended by the Western Australian Electoral Commisioner, including -
providing for the formal registration of political parties; enabling greater efficiency and convenience in the casting and processing of absentee and postal votes, and in candidate nominations; and
removing a number of obsolete provisions from the Electoral Act 1907. |
Status | Legislative Council Second Reading 06/29/2000 This Act comes into operation on a day fixed by Proclamation |
